Maltese[edit]

Root
ż-w-r
3 terms

Etymology[edit]

From Arabic زارَ (zāra, to visit).

Pronunciation[edit]

Verb[edit]

żar (imperfect jżur, past participle miżjur)

  1. to visit
  2. (usually in the imperative) to make way, to get out of the way
    Żurli minn-nofsGet out of the way for me.

Polish[edit]

Polish Wikipedia has an article on:
Wikipedia pl
żar

Etymology[edit]

Inherited from Old Polish żar.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/ʐar/
  • (file)
  • Rhymes: -ar
  • Syllabification: żar

Noun[edit]

żar m inan

  1. ember (glowing coals or wood)
  2. extreme heat
